The One-Person Infrastructure Firm
Solo builders armed with AI are successfully designing and deploying complex systems that previously required institutional backing or well-funded engineering teams, collapsing the optimal team size to one.
Trajectory
The fundamental scarcity has shifted from implementation capability to problem intimacy. Individuals are now single-handedly shipping national weather platforms, custom browser engines, hardware-accelerated math proofs, and secure email clients—work that structurally required a firm or government agency just a few years ago.
